    Maf?

    I saw modest gains on the dyno using a c&l maf on my gt when it was n/a. You have to use the c&l inlet pipe too to avoid check engine lights (More flow then stock units). I would expect 5-7 whp.

    swapping pulleyon my V2-Sq got ??

    No pulley remover needed. Simply remove the bolt while the belt is still on, remove the belt off the alt and slide off the old pulley, and slide on the new one. Be careful not to drop the key when you slide them on and off. I also put a small drop of medium strength thread locker on the bolt...

    swapping pulleyon my V2-Sq got ??

    What pulley do you have now ? Do you have an intercooler ? If you still have the stock 3.6 pulley, a 3.3 is a big jump in boost. The 3.3 pulley with a power pipe and no intercooler will make 12-14lbs of boost and will definitely require a dyno tune to be safe. The steeda tune is ok for small...

    Swaybar with coilovers??

    You should keep your swaybar no matter what setup unless you don't care about going around turns. If it is mainly a drag car and you don't mind taking it easy around turns then you can take it off. Coilovers do not make up for a missing swaybar. The swaybar performs a much different job then the...
